Anti-Aging Skincare Routine for the Smoothest Skin
First off, and mayyybee the most important of all of these products, is my facial toner. Facial toner helps to correct and balance the pH of your skin, which makes sense why it helps with acne as well! This one feels so light and refreshing and works wonders. You can use it on a cotton pad and wipe your skin with it {which I do when I feel like I have extra oil and really need it to cleanse & balance even more} or just spritz it on since it also comes with a spray nozzle. Most days, I just spritz it on after rinsing and drying my face and then let it dry before moving to my next product. Super easy! {I know this toner is a little pricey, but it does last a long time! Once the toner dries, I use this serum. I mainly was looking for something to brighten my skin and make it look younger and more awake, while also fighting off all the environmental factors that can damage skin like free radicals etc. This serum promotes skin radiance with its antioxidant properties and by replenishing lipids, reducing dark spots & dissolving dead skin cells. Even better, it does all of these things while being cruelty-free and made without additional, potentially harmful ingredients!
TIP: This serum is also great for your neck and backs of your hands where age shows often more quickly than the rest of the body!

This retinol firming eye cream helps reduce dark circles under the eyes as well as fine lines and wrinkles. Retinol helps to stimulate the products of new skin cells and can even help with acne scars. After using it, my eye area feels so smooth and I even feel more awake from it {I know that’s probably totally psychological lol!} Even though this is a retinol product, I never experienced any discomfort or reaction to it.
